Most of the sealants are made using a liquid resin and it is brushed in the teeth for the teeth to be hardened. However, some composite resins used in dental materials might contain tiny amounts of BPA, and trace amounts of BPA used in the production of other ingredients used in dental composites and sealants could find their way into sealants. After roughening, the teeth are rinsed and dried again. Still, BPA continues to be used in many products. The risk of shrinkage is reduced if the dentist installs the filling gradually, in thin layers. Small levels of BPA are shown to rise in saliva for up to three hours after the procedure, then disappear after 24 hours. The reasons for fissure sealant failure are saliva contamination while placing the sealant, lack of clinical experience, uncooperative patient, and less potent tooth sealant material used. A CDC report stated that about 43% of children between the ages of 6 and 11 have dental sealant. The approach does facilitate the prevention and the early intervention which helps to stop and to prevent the process of the dental caries before it can reach to the end-stage of disease. The American Dental Association says that adding a sealant to a single tooth can reduce the risk of a cavity developing by up to 86% in the first 12 months. If the bacteria are trapped in such way, it is the reason behind the cavities and the sealant can protect the tooth against the caries at once. This percentage is higher among kids from higher-income families, at 40 percent, but that's still not even half of the children in the United States.
